Young scientists about the updated Constitution

On the eve of the upcoming April 30 important political process, a campaign event dedicated to the referendum was organized for students.

The event was attended by the head of the department of the Executive Committee of the Political Council of UzLiDeP, a member of the Youth Parliament Otabek Sobitov, students of Tashkent Chemical-Technological Institute.

At the event, information was provided on the articles of the Basic Law that provide young people with the opportunity to realize their aspirations, personal development and find their place in society by mastering modern professions, the norms introduced into the updated Constitution that provide for the academic freedom of higher education institutions, free higher education at the expense of the state based on the competition, support for non-governmental non-profit organizations.

The youth spoke about the reforms carried out in recent years aimed at supporting young scientists and called for active participation in the referendum to be held on April 30.
